DI2220V301R-00 Equivalent & Substitute Parts

Part Overview

The DI2220V301R-00 is a 300 nH unshielded drum core wirewound inductor manufactured by Laird-Signal Integrity Products. This surface mount component is rated for 8 A continuous current with a maximum DC resistance of 10 mOhm, designed for high-frequency applications tested at 25 MHz. The part is currently classified as obsolete, necessitating identification of active equivalent alternatives to maintain supply chain continuity for existing designs and new production requirements.

Engineering Selection Recommendations

The DI2220V301R-10 is the direct active equivalent for the obsolete DI2220V301R-00. Selection of the substitute part is based on the following engineering criteria:

Product Status: The DI2220V301R-10 maintains Active product status, ensuring continued availability and manufacturer support. The original DI2220V301R-00 is classified as Obsolete, creating supply chain risk for ongoing production and field replacements.

Compliance & Certifications: The DI2220V301R-10 is ROHS3 compliant, meeting current regulatory requirements for electronic components in regulated markets. The original part is RoHS non-compliant, which may restrict its use in new designs subject to RoHS directives.

Electrical & Mechanical Equivalence: All critical electrical parameters (inductance, current rating, DC resistance, core material, shielding) and mechanical parameters (footprint, mounting type, operating temperature range) are identical between the two parts.

Packaging Consideration: The DI2220V301R-10 is supplied in standard Tape & Reel (TR) packaging, compared to the nonstandard packaging of the original part. This facilitates automated assembly processes and improves supply chain efficiency.

Physical Dimension Variance: The seated height differs by 0.26 mm (3.60 mm vs. 3.86 mm). This minor variation must be evaluated against specific PCB layout and clearance requirements in the target application.
